What are Local LLMs?

Local LLMs refer to language models that are deployed and run on local devices, such as laptops, desktops, or even mobile devices. This approach eliminates the need for cloud connectivity, reducing latency and improving data privacy. Open-Source AI

Open-source AI refers to the development and sharing of AI-related software and models under open-source licenses. This approach has led to the creation of numerous open-source AI frameworks and tools, such as TensorFlow, PyTorch, and Hugging Face Transformers. Open-source AI promotes collaboration, transparency, and community-driven development, resulting in faster innovation and improved model performance.
